Re: [Xen-devel] HVM RTC where is it initially set where is it	respected? 
| It no longer works via qemu, that portion is disconnected. 
 You can currently set a new time offset for an HVM domain, but there is
no current mechanism to read the time offset or get notification if an
HVM guest changes it.
 
 I submitted a patch a week or so back to implement these, but the status of that is uncertain (at least to me).
 I guess I should revisit the status of the patch.

 On 3/26/07, Ross S. W. Walker <rwalker@xxxxxxxxxxxxx> wrote:
When the rtc for hvms was moved from qemu to hvm was the whole operation moved over?
 
 What I am getting at is that the initial time should probably still be set in qemu
 and hvm rtc should respect it. That way the -localtime option would still work as
 advertised and there would be no need to have ported gmtime() over.
 
 Also any adjustments done to the rtc in the hvm during run-time should be at the
 second and millisecond level as guests might have their clocks set to other times
 or timezones, either because they are running Windows, or are being set forward or
 backwards for testing purposes.
